The HP StorageWorks 6218 Virtual Library System (Part Number: AH809B) is a hard drive array designed specifically to enhance digital storage capabilities. This system is created for enterprises that require high-performance storage solutions which can accommodate growing data management needs. It functions as part of the HP Virtual Library System (VLS), a scalable platform providing larger, more efficient storage to meet modern data backup and retrieval demands.
The VLS 6218 comes equipped with substantial storage capacity, effectively streamlining data backup processes across a network. As a virtual tape library (VTL) system, it emulates physical tape libraries, which enables backup administrators to integrate it efficiently into existing data protection environments. This makes it highly useful in reducing complexities associated with traditional tape-based archives.
Physically, the HP StorageWorks 6218 is housed in a rackmountable format, optimising available data centre space. It offers an intuitive interface for ease of management and monitoring of storage operations. The hard drive array features multiple high-capacity drives, configured for performance, ensuring that backup and data recovery times are minimised. Additionally, its data deduplication technology helps reduce storage space by eliminating redundant copies during backup, ensuring optimal usage of available capacity.
By incorporating advanced redundancy features, including RAID support, the HP StorageWorks 6218 safeguards data against drive failures. It significantly enhances operational efficiency by reducing manual intervention often required with physical tape backups. Overall, this model is ideal for organisations prioritising reliability and constant data availability.
